Title: S1 Fulvia Coupe Indicator stalk mechanism
Post by: ncundy on 28 July, 2008, 08:05:15 PM
Does anyone have an S1 Fulvia indicator stalk ? I am not too concerned with the metal work, it is the mechanism inside I need - on mine the plastic housing around the return arm pivots has broken.

Thanks very much, it is  just the job. I have stripped it and internally it is in excellent condition. It is also in detail different to mine (they both have the same Caem part #). The spring arrangment on the indicator cancel arms is much better and more robust than the arrangement on mine. So all cleaned and reassembled in my externals and looks super.
